Panna cotta is a traditional Italian custard. It is made with ⅓ cup skim milk, 1 envelope unflavored gelatin, 2 ½ cups heavy cream, ½ cup white sugar, and 1 ½ teaspoons vanilla extract.

Panna cotta is made of milk and cream and sugar and vanilla seeds and gelatine. Panna cotta is made of 150ml milk and 400ml double cream and 60g caster sugar and 1 vanilla pod and 2 ½ sheets gelatine.

Panna cotta is a silky, eggless custard thickened with a touch of gelatin. This easy panna cotta recipe is an especially rich version made with all cream instead of a mix of cream and milk. Only a small amount of gelatin is used, yielding a pudding that's tender, not rubbery.
